5. (a) The electric current I, in amperes, in a circuit varies directly as the voltage V. When 12
volts are applied, the current is 4 amperes. What is the current when 18 volts are applied?
(b) If 32 men can reap a field in 15 days, in how many days can 20 men reap the same field?

100 people were asked if they liked Math, Science, or Social Studies. Everyone answered
that they liked at least one. 56 like Math. 43 like Science. 35 like Social Studies. 18 like Math
and Science. 10 like Science and Social Studies. 12 like Math and Social Studies.
6 like all
three subjects
